The housing market in Kitzmiller is relatively stable, with a mix of older and newer homes available. Rentals are limited, but affordable options can be found. The town’s small size and rural location contribute to its charm and slower pace of life.

☀️ Seasonal Utility Costs

Utility costs in Kitzmiller vary by season, with higher electricity bills in summer due to air conditioning and higher propane costs in winter for heating. Residents can expect to pay around 10-20% more for utilities during peak seasons.
